Beverly Donofrio


The Taker and the Keeper
by Wim Coleman and Pat Perrin

Middle-schoolers Gregory Guest and Yolanda Torres have no intention of becoming heroes. But as the only kids in Bainsboro who see that the world has gone horribly wrong, what choice do they have? Aided by their eccentric science teacher and Gregory’s trusty red monocle, Gregory and Yolanda travel into the King Arthur legend to save today’s “real” world from a legendary threat. As they ally themselves with the magician Merlin and his young apprentice to thwart the sorceress Morgan le Fay’s machinations, these reluctant heroes must set whole worlds right again. The first book in the Red Monocle series by Wim Coleman and Pat Perrin, The Taker and the Keeper will keep young readers up at night as they get swept away in this tightly-plotted, hair-raising adventure.

Payshapes cover

Payshapes and the Bear/Péxeps y el Oso
by Lucina Kathmann
Somewhere in Latin America, a man named Payshapes (Péxeps in Spanish) lives in the deep forest. He and his best friend Bear (who is a bear) have many lighthearted adventures with a recurring cast of characters including a few dragons. Written for children, Payshapes and the Bear is a story that appeals to all ages. Unique illustrations by Fabián Nanni.

Lucina Kathmann is a novelist, short story writer, journalist, and essayist in Spanish and English. She is an International Vice President of International PEN. Péxeps y el Oso was originally published in Argentina by Editorial Biblioteca de Textos Universitarios. ChironBooks is proud to publish the first U.S. edition.

Upcoming from ChironBooks:

More exciting adventures in the Red Monocle series
What do we lose when a great story goes missing? How do myths and legends affect us day to day? Twelve-year-old Gregory Guest is about to find out! For he owns a marvelous red monocle that allows him to pass through a mysterious tunnel to a place where stories from cultures everywhere come alive. Readers are invited to join Gregory and his friends on thrilling adventures in the new Red Monocle series from authors Wim Coleman and Pat Perrin. The Taker and The Keeper and The Death of the Good Wizard feature King Arthur and his knights; The Invisible Foe introduces the African trickster Anansi, who first unleashed stories into the world. In further Red Monocle books, young readers will delight in experiencing more great myths and legends.

A Forest of Mathematics
A novel and math book at once by Lucina Kathmann. The animal characters in a forest present negative numbers, Cartesian coordinates, exponents, fractions, decimals, and percents through "real-life" (of the forest) situations, worksheets included, and a wayward young dragon who is redeemed through math. Tweens, teens and imaginative adults. Bilingual, text in English and Spanish. The U.S. edition will be available in late 2009.

The Wand Bearer Trilogy
Written for teens and older by Wim Coleman and Pat Perrin. When a ragtag circus shows up in the town of Buchanan, Kansas, fourteen-year-old Randy Carmichael begins a quest beyond mortal imagination. Voices summon him, a godlike figure appears in his dreams, and supernatural adversaries lay in wait for him as he learns about his identity and destiny. When gods grow old to the brink of death, Randy plays a role in their wondrous rebirth. And when he falls in love with an immortal goddess, he must journey into a realm dreaded by mortals everywhere. By the end of Randy’s quest, our very world will never be the same. Juggler in the Wind, the first book of The Wand Bearer Trilogy, will appear in February 2010, to be followed by Star Road and Otherworld.
